AUBURN -- Teutopolis Junior High School's seventh-grade girls basketball squad captured the Class 7-3A State Tournament championship Thursday evening.

Teutopolis squared off against St. Joseph and the two squads had a defensive battle throughout. T-town held a 6-2 first quarter lead and led 10-7 at halftime.  Both teams tallied seven in the third quarter and nine in the final period.

Olivia Niemerg led T-town with 13 points. Hannah Dukeman led St. Joseph with 14. T-town ends the season with a perfect 28-0 record. St. Joseph finishes at 24-2 with both losses this year coming at the hands of Teutopolis.

The third place game went to Pleasant Plains over Peotone 43-21.

The girls and their coaches will be honored for their accomplishments with a parade/fire truck ride beginning at Teutopolis Junior High School at 1:30 p.m. Sunday. There will be a reception to follow in James A. Hakman Gymnasium at Teutopolis Junior High School.

In the Class 7-1A State Tournament, Decatur Our Lady of Lourdes downed Pontiac St. Mary's 37-10 for third place while Lincoln West Lincoln-Broadwell defeated Jacksonville Our Saviour 38-27 for the championship.

In the Class 7-2A State Tournament, Assumption Central A&M edged Princeville 33-31 for third place. Colfax Ridgeview downed Lewistown Central 36-33 for the state title.
